Mandalay is the second capital of the Union of Myanmar. It’s also the center for Myanmar cultural hub. If you happen to visit Mandalay, you must make it a must to include Mandalay Cultural Museum in your list of itinerary. And when in Mandalay, don’t miss the opportunity of visiting the Mandalay Cultural Museum. The Mandalay Cultural Museum is situated at the corner of 80th and 24th streets. It was opened on May the 6th, 1955. There are over 3,000 interesting items exhibited at this Museum. When you enter the museum, the first exhibit that you will encounter is the exhibit of items and utensils used by the ancient Myanmar civilization. |

The museum is also exhibiting weapons made from stone and bronze used by ancient civilization. Besides the Stone Age artifacts used by the Stone Age civilization, you can also see other Stone Age items. This exhibit depicts the ancient Myanmar civilization. You can also study in details the paintings of the Yadanabon period Myanmar artists. These paintings show the way of life of Myanmar Palace customs and the character of the Myanmar people, thus, after studying these paintings, you will come to know how the Myanmar people lived and worked throughout their history. Myanmar Traditional “SitTuYin” or chess is a traditional Myanmar game, which is not played like the western chess, and was invented by the Myanmar, themselves. As these chess pieces are made of ivory, they are expensive and quite attractive to look at. You will find this exhibit very interesting. |

In the Yadanabon period exhibit, you will also see the HinTha or Mythical bird weights used in this period where buying and selling was concerned and you will realize that they did systematic business in that period. The area of Yadanabon period Mandalay city is depicted artistically on a map made of writing tablet. Another exhibit is the helmet used by ancient Myanmar soldiers. In the same exhibit, you will be able to study for yourself the royal order sent out by the Place, Silver coins and boxes which contains all sorts of letters. In another exhibit, palm-leaf inscriptions from the Yadanabon and KoneBaung periods are displayed. And we will be able to study the Myanmar traditional glass mosaic technique that we used in the Yadanabon period at the Buddhist Cultural exhibit, which is exhibiting glass mosaic items from Buddha images to thrones and utensils used by the Yadanabon period. The Buddhist monks who resided in monasteries of the Innwa period used to put in palm-leaf inscriptions and writing tablets in boxes in the shape of a mythical creature, called the “Toe Nayar” which is said to inhibit the Himalayan regions. |

Besides all the above-mentioned items, you will also find the arched-roof cart, looms to weave clothings, accessories for the looms, and other items made from toddy-palm leaves, used by Myanmar people in successive eras. There is also the Myanmar ten traditional arts and crafts exhibition. Thus, you can study Myanmar culture, customs, arts and crafts in a single place except Mondays and gazette holidays.
